Finding an ideal family-friendly hotel in Marathokampos does not have to be difficult. Welcome to Kampos Village Resort, a nice option for travelers like you.

Rooms at Kampos Village Resort offer a refrigerator, a kitchenette, and air conditioning providing exceptional comfort and convenience, and guests can go online with free wifi.

A 24 hour front desk and a sun terrace are some of the conveniences offered at this hotel. A pool and free breakfast will also help to make your stay even more special. If you are driving to Kampos Village Resort, free parking is available.

While you’re here, be sure to check out some of the Mediterranean restaurants, including Kampos Grill, Argo Taverna, and Blue Bucket Restaurant, all of which are a short distance from Kampos Village Resort.

Kampos Village Resort puts the best of Marathokampos at your fingertips, making your stay both relaxing and enjoyable.

Daniel wrote a review Mar 2024
Warsaw, Poland
4.0 of 5 bubbles
A very nice hotel composed of many small buildings. 3 different swimming pools. The food is a plus, every dinner is prepared live. Several special/regional dishes different every day. Of course, 70% is repeated, but this 30% is enough to fill you up and satisfy you. All inclusive also includes free alcoholic drinks with meals. The hotel is located on a hill, you have to walk a bit from the main street. There is a large grocery store right at the entrance to the street. Rooms clean, cleaned every 2 days. The service was nice and helpful. They helped with our stay with our 1-year-old child without any problems. There is also a small playground at the hotel, but it is in full sun and can only be used in the evenings. There is a large parking lot right next to the hotel, and there are many car rental companies in the immediate vicinity. The 3* of this hotel is much better than some 4* hotels.

Bo wrote a review Jul 2022
Cologne, Germany
2.0 of 5 bubbles
As long time greece travellers... this Hotel has the lowest quality breakfast we ever experienced. Same for the drinks at the pool bar.
You are forced the wear a plastic wristband (to distinguish breakfast only, half board, full board). These bands are very annoying. They also have sharp edges and my son hurt himself with it when he scratched his face while sleeping.
Rooms are out of fashion but okay. Beds are not very comfortable. Bathroom very small.
Towels and sheets are changed twice a week. On sunday no room service, only the rubbish bin gets emptied.
